Buy off-the-shelf software when a product covers most of what you need and the process is standard. Build custom software when the way you work is part of your advantage, when you are paying for seats to get one feature, or when your team spends real time working around a tool that does not fit. Most businesses end up doing some of both. This guide walks through how to tell which situation you are in.

When you buy software you are renting more than features. You are renting a product roadmap, a support organization, a security team, a compliance posture somebody else paid to certify, and the accumulated result of thousands of other customers finding the bugs before you did. You can usually start the same day, and the cost is predictable.
The costs show up in three places. The first is fit: a product built for the widest possible market will not match your process exactly, and the gap gets filled with workarounds, spreadsheets, and manual steps. The second is scale: per-seat pricing is affordable at ten users and expensive at a hundred, and it keeps rising. The third is control: your data lives in someone else's system, the roadmap is theirs, and integrations go only as far as the product allows.
Custom software is built around the way you already work. You own it, there is no per-seat pricing, it connects to exactly the systems you need, and it can encode the part of your process that is genuinely yours.
It also comes with responsibilities. There is an upfront cost. It needs maintenance: budget roughly 5 to 20 percent of the build cost each year, plus hosting. The roadmap becomes yours, which means someone has to decide what comes next. And you have to be able to describe what the software should do; if nobody can, building is premature.
Custom software gives you exactly what you asked for and nothing you did not. That is its strength and its limit.
For years, custom software meant a team of five to seven people for three to six months, which put a moderate build well into six figures. Most of those hours went into implementation work that required care but not judgment: scaffolding, data layers, forms, test harnesses, integration glue.
AI-assisted development compresses that layer dramatically. It does not compress architecture, data modeling, security review, or knowing what to build, so experienced engineers still matter as much as ever. But a small team now produces what used to need a large one, on the work where the compression applies.
The practical consequence: if you priced a custom build a few years ago and walked away, the assumptions behind that quote may be obsolete. The most common good answer is neither pure build nor pure buy. Keep mature products for the commodity work, such as accounting, payroll, email, and often your CRM. Build the layer that is specific to your business on top of them, and connect the two so nobody re-keys data between them.
That is how most custom software actually gets used: a client portal that pulls documents from the systems you already run, an internal tool that replaces the spreadsheet between two products, or an AI agent that works inside the CRM your team lives in.

SaaS costs less to start and more over time as seats grow; custom software costs more to start and less over time. For example, forty users at $45 per seat cost $21,600 a year, while a $28,000 custom tool costing about $4,000 a year to maintain pays for itself in about nineteen months. These are illustrative figures, not a quote.
